Hi Mark & everyone,

Now *that* was a funny post - actually, I used to post on here every single day, back when I had the time to do so - now I'm lucky to get here once a week to try to get all the posts caught up, so my technique of analyzing everyone's online behaviors and altering their tunes accordingly has kinda gone out the window!

All kidding aside, it's funny you mention that, as we *do* tailor our custom tunes for the individual, and we do certainly have some people that we have to tune for differently. For example, JMC we know has been pounding on his F-150's that we've been tuning for a decade, as does his buddy and a good friend of mine we all know here as "Neal the HP Freak" - these are a couple of characters that I have to be real careful tuning, as I know they are going to pound on their vehicles for everything they are worth - now Neal probably pounds on his *engine* harder than JMC overall, but then, Neal also tends to break more hardware - I think he's found every weak link in the F-150 and broken it a time or 6 - so these days everything he installs is vast overkill, and even then, will die sooner or later - Neal doesn't like anyone getting past him. He just killed a Lightning with his 1999 non-nitrous non-supercharged 5.4 F-150 that is running an 8.5:1 compression naturally aspirated motor with our full race cylinder head package - the Lightning owner was in disbelief.

So yes, there are a few characters here we actually have to tune differently for due to their personality/driving style - and God bless them, as we love it!
